An advanced Google dorking query like inurl:indexframe.shtml "axis video server" is frequently used by security researchers, network administrators, and penetration testers to locate exposed Axis Communications video servers. Understanding why this query works, what vulnerabilities it highlights, and how to properly secure these devices is critical for modern network security.
